#0bbd02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0bbd02 is composed of 4.3% red, 74.1%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.9%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 117.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 37.5%. #0bbd02 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ff04 with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#0bbd02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0bbd02 has RGB values of R:11, G:189,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 769282.

Shades and Tints of #0bbd02
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e00 is the darkest color, while #fafffa is the lightest one.
